FACTS ABOUT THE FY25 HOMELAND SECURITY APPROPRIATIONS BILL (Courtesy of House Appropriations Republicans):
- Secures our Southern Border by:
- Providing $600 million for the construction of the Southern Border wall.
- Forcing Secretary Mayorkas to adhere to the law and build physical barriers immediately.
- Ensuring wall funding can only be used to build physical barriers by attaching stricter conditions and shorter timelines to put the funds on contract.
- Sustaining funding for 22,000 Border Patrol agents.
- Providing $300 million for border security technology.
- Removes dangerous criminals by:
- Providing $4.1 billion for custody operations, which is more than ever previously appropriated, to fund 50,000 detention beds.
- Providing $822 million to fund transportation and removal operations for removable aliens.
- Counters Communist China and bolsters national security by:
- Providing $335 million to procure four additional Coast Guard Fast Response Cutters.
- Providing $60 million for a service life extension to enable the Coast Guard to deploy another Medium Endurance Cutter to the Indo-Pacific.
- Providing $4.2 million for increased maritime engagements with allies and partners in the Indo-Pacific.
- Encouraging federal, state, local, and private sector partners to replace communications technology from companies designated as a national security risk.
- Focuses the Department on its core responsibilities by:
- Preventing the Department from carrying out its equity action plan or advancing critical race theory.
- Rejecting funding for electric vehicles and related infrastructure, saving $30 million.
- Preventing the consolidation of the Department’s Headquarters, saving $186.7 million.
- Rejecting funding requested by the Biden Administration that encourages more illegal migration, such as:
- The Shelter and Services Program for migrants, $650 million less than the Fiscal Year 2024 enacted level.
- The Case Management Pilot Program for migrants, $20 million less than the Fiscal Year 2024 enacted level.
- Eliminating the duplicative Office of the Immigration Detention Ombudsman, saving $28.6 million from the Fiscal Year 2024 enacted level.
- Excluding the Administration’s $4.7 billion Southwest border contingency slush fund that would provide funds to process and release more aliens into the country.
- Supports American values and principles by:
- Prohibiting the government from labeling Americans’ constitutionally protected speech as “misinformation” and imposing a penalty of termination for such action.
- Prohibiting funding for providing or facilitating abortions for ICE detainees.
- Prohibiting gender-affirming care, including hormone therapy and surgery, for ICE detainees.
